La introducción del sistema de termostato refrigerado por líquido que circula auto-HobbyKing de 36 mm motor alimentado rc coches.

El sistema de refrigeración líquida consiste en un radiador con bomba de circulación eléctrica integrada, la tubería de refrigerante, y un líquido refrigerado placa de montaje del motor. Con sólo cambiar a cabo el soporte del motor, conectar el radiador y ejecutar 2 líneas de refrigeración. La bomba viene con un adaptador en Y para ir en medio de su receptor y el cable de alimentación BEC, dibujo solamente 12 mA de potencia para circular.

Esto es grande para las miradas escala y donde el flujo de aire podría ser un problema, y ​​es perfecto para aquellos que sólo quieren añadir el seguro adicional sobre su inversión.

Especificaciones:
Monte dimensiones: 36 mm Para 47x35x6mm en-corredor motores (excepto el grifo de)
Las dimensiones del radiador / bomba: 45x60x15mm
Peso total: <45g
Fuente de alimentación: 3,7 ~ 5V
El consumo de corriente: 12 mA

I've installed two of these pump and "coil" (not radiator) units in an LC system to cool the gear driven in-runner Neumotor in my Great Planes P6E Hawk.
Since the install is in a airplane that can be flow at negative Gs, I used two in tandem, so if one of the inertia pumps ingests an air bubble the other will push it through to the reservoir/ air trap I have installed.
The cooling performs with great alacrity. With the pumps on, maximum motor temperature is ambient 15F. With the pumps turned off, the motor temperature increases at a continuous rate about 30F/minute.
There are some concerns with reliability. The pump wires gauge is very conservative, so I soldered on regular servo extension wires and secured them to the motor bodies with HST. Also, since the pumps are driven by coreless motors, the MTBF is somewhat limited. Whilst these motors can be easily replaced with other off the shelf units, brushless motor powered pumps are far more desirable. After all, changing a motor pump involves draining and recharging the cooling system.

This great little unit. It doesn't exactly what it says it does. I cannot believe the amount of water volume that this little tiny pump circulates. However, it is unrepairable if a lead should come off the motor. At $37 US you'd expect to be able to repair this pump. My unit was damaged right out of the box unfortunately, I didn't notice it until I had installed it in my boat. The leads that go to the motor are so tiny that any amount of movement or vibration will cause it to break. The motor has no soldering tabs on it so the leads go into the motor. Once they break the unit is useless. There is no way of repairing it. They need to redesign it with soldering tabs on the motor so different leads can be used. This is my only negative thing about this product.
